ok so i got a 01 ranger xlt offroad and i got 265/75r16s on it im going to be lifting it around 5 inch or more no body lift will 35inch tires be to big for stock gearing and if so what kinda gearing should i look into getting
 
Last edited:
What kind of gearing do you have now? with 35'' tires you will need new gears either way
 
If you have 4.10 gears now you could live with it, barely, if it's a automatic. But 4.56's or 4.88's would be a lot better.
Secondly, no one makes a 5" suspension lift for late-models. Superlift's kit is 4" and to clear 35's you'll need either a body lift on top of that or fiberglass flared front fenders.
Also know that the late-model front end is not real happy with tires larger than 33", so get used to changing wheel bearings, tie rod ends, ball joints, and the occasional snapped CV joint and halfshaft if you actually go off-road with it.
